The Tzu Chi Collegiate Association is the collegiate branch of Tzu Chi. They hold volunteer events multiple times a week to help out in the community and provide opportunities for busy college students to do volunteer work within the local area that is rewarding and meaningful. They are a registered student organization at UC Davis.
They participate in a weekly Sunday breakfast distribution near the Sacramento Salvation Army shelter and do other events such as e-waste recycling, bone marrow registry drives, food/clothing donation drives, and book distributions to local school children. They follow Tzu Chi's 8 main missions, which are:
- Charity - Educating the rich to help the poor; inspiring the poor to realize their riches
- Medicine - Patient-centered medical care that respects patients as teachers
- Education - Educating children to be moral and upright
- Culture - Recording the examples of goodness and integrity for future generations
- International Relief - Caring for people in suffering in the global village
- Bone Marrow Donation - Donating your marrow to save a life without harming yourself
- Environmental Protection - Practicing environmental protection to live in harmony with Mother Earth
- Community Volunteers - By supporting and caring for each other, they make a beautiful neighborhood
